RETIREMENT OF INDEPENDENT NON-EXECUTIVE DIRECTOR

In accordance with Paragraph 3.59 of the Listing Requirements of the JSE Limited, the Board
of Frontier Transport Holdings Limited, wishes to advise shareholders, that Dr Naziema
Jappie, will retire as an independent non-executive director of the Company, with effect from
01 September 2023.

Dr Naziema Jappie, served in the capacity of an independent non-executive director since
the Company’s listing on 24 April 2018. Dr Naziema Jappie will also retire as a member of
the Board Committees, on which she presently serves.

The Board would like to thank Dr Naziema Jappie for her years of excellent leadership and
commitment to the businesses of the Group and wish her the very best in her retirement.

The Board will immediately commence with the process of appointing a successor
independent non-executive director and a further announcement will be made in due course.
